You will need an Amazon Web Services (AWS) account to run the examples included in this chapter. If you haven't got one already, please browse to https://aws.amazon.com/getting-started/ to create it. You should also familiarize yourself with the AWS Free Tier (https://aws.amazon.com/free/), which lets you use many AWS services for free within certain usage limits.
You will need to install and configure the AWS command-line interface (CLI) tool for your account (https://aws.amazon.com/cli/).
You will need a working Python 3.x environment. Installing the Anaconda distribution (https://www.anaconda.com/) is not mandatory but strongly encouraged, as it includes many projects that we will need (Jupyter, pandas, numpy, and more).
The code examples included in the book are available on GitHub at https://github.com/PacktPublishing/Learn-Amazon-SageMaker-second-edition. You will need to install a Git client to access them (https://git-scm.com/).
